Supporting one of OryxAlign's key clients, professionally representing our business and delivering customer remote and facing on-site support, maintenance and planned change activity to our client-managed office space and office, retail and residential properties in London and across the UK. The portfolio consists of flagship buildings in London and several large retail shopping centres in major UK cities. context London-based to cover network, PC, and server support for all locations across the UK. As part of the properties' on-site support team servicing incidents and requests, scoping, planning and implementation, tenant onboarding, small works for service and network upgrades for their and other properties' clients. key responsibilities
The engineer will represent both OryxAlign and our client in delivering support for the infrastructure and to users of the managed office and office, retail and residential properties
Planning and execution of onboarding and configuration of physical infrastructure and connectivity
Manage and implement physical patching and cable management and changes. Managing capacity and demand planning to ensure sufficient resources are available and performant
Managing shared printing services, set up and admin. Assisting clients and tenants with support and troubleshooting
Administer/assist with setup and provision of telephony
Own and manage general connectivity issues for dependent services, printing, audio-visual, etc.
Network cabled and wireless management and maintenance, troubleshooting issues, planning changes, and capacity requirements
Logging and classifying tickets against SLA
Site attendance or remotely remediating logged service requests
Scheduled site attendance to perform PPM "Planned preventive maintenance"
Device management in RMM for adherence to asset registers
Replacement of failed equipment
Fibre & cat5 patching
Quarterly review of RMM
Administration of Radius server
Weekend and out-of-hours work may be required
3rd party vendor management and close working in resolving issues
Scope, planning and implementation of small works
Participate in On Call out-of-hours rotation
